Edward Norton graduated from Yale University in 1991 with a BA in history, where he took a strong interest and involvement in theater with fellow classmate and future actor Ron Livingston. After graduation he taught English as a second language at NOVA Group in Japan before professionally pursuing an acting career.
In New York City Edward Norton broke into the world of theater with off-Broadway and became a member of the Signature Players, which produced playwright and director Edward Albee’s works. His film debut in the 1996 flick Primal Fear, co-starring Richard Gere and Laura Linney, garnered him a Golden Globe and a nomination for an Oscar for his portrayal of a sociopath convict.
The role was originally offered to actor Leonardo DiCaprio, but he turned it down before Norton snatched it up. Edward Norton was later offered roles in The People vs. Larry Flynt with Woody Harrelson and Courtney Love as well as Woody Allen’s Everyone Says I Love You with Drew Barrymore.
Edward Norton went on to portray a violent white supremacist in American History X in 1998, garnering him another Oscar nomination for Best Actor. The following year he became insanely popular along with Brad Pitt for Fight Club, and in 2000 Edward Norton directed for the first time in Keeping the Faith, a romantic-comedy film in which he also acted opposite Ben Stiller and Jenna Elfman.
Other notable films featuring Edward Norton include Rounders, with Matt Damon in 1998, Red Dragon in 2002, with Anthony Hopkins and Ralph Fiennes; The Italian Job in 2003, with a stellar cast including Mark Wahlberg, Charlize Theron, Donald Sutherland, and Seth Green; and Kingdom of Heaven in 2005, in which he played a leper king.
